EDIT: i was wrong, so i edited my post... I supposed that the fee wasn't high enough (70 satoshi's per byte instead of the preffered 110 satoshis per byte), and i started to explain your options, but since the tx is already confirmed, this would be useless information, so i deleted it.
In reality,
https://blockchain.info/tx/71ce7073436d2b8b1d5c7e278ab056134c89e59ca3c42c1eb148ed84376c8ae0 is already included in a block, it has +300 confirmations.
I do find it strange tough,
https://blockchain.info/address/1GBkX2KuHDdLRhGP7ZtBGJwyeU9CkfMmVd only received a ~0.00015
BTC input from transaction 71ce7073436d2b8b1d5c7e278ab056134c89e59ca3c42c1eb148ed84376c8ae0
What i
suspect happened: you asked for a 0.15 mBTC withdrawal instead of a 0.15 BTC withdrawal.
This way, you might be looking for the wrong amount in your coinbase wallet, since you expect 0.15
BTC instead of 0.00015
BTC... If you can't even see 0.00015
BTC in your coinbase account, double check the deposit address, and see what fees and minimum amounts are required by coinbase.
If you really asked for 0.15
BTC and not 0.00015
BTC, it's also possible BitsForClicks made an error, in this case you should contact their support dept.
